I did mine like this - was from a recipie I found on here
Mashed potatoes
Tin of tuna
Mix together
I added some herbs (any you fancy)
Rolled in flour then brush on a little egg yolk and then coat in bread crumbs and slightly brown them in frying pan. I then put them in the oven to finish off.It's nice to be nutty but's more important to be nice0
